Competitive salary Annual bonus opportunity Life assurance Enhanced holiday allowance Career development and progression opportunities Access to Refresco's employee benefits platform, Cheers Healthcare and wellbeing benefits Free online medical support Company pension scheme Opportunity to lead a critical engineering function within a state-of-the-art manufacturing facility About the Role Reporting to the Head of Engineering, you will lead the Process and Utilities Engineering functions across the Bridgwater site, ensuring the delivery of safe, compliant, reliable, and cost-effective process plant and utility services. You will provide leadership to the Process and Utilities Engineering Team Leaders and their teams, while taking ownership of engineering performance, maintenance strategy, statutory compliance, asset reliability, resource efficiency, and continuous improvement activities. This role is pivotal in connecting process plant performance with the utility services that support it, ensuring optimal product quality, operational performance, sustainability, and long-term asset health. What will you be doing? Leading and developing the Process and Utilities Engineering teams, creating a high-performing and accountable engineering culture. Owning maintenance and reliability strategies for process plant and utility assets. Ensuring compliance with relevant legislation and company standards, including PSSR, PUWER, LOLER, DSEAR and Legionella requirements. Managing engineering priorities, maintenance interventions, contractor performance and resource deployment. Driving asset reliability improvements through planned, preventative and condition-based maintenance strategies. Leading root cause analysis activities following significant breakdowns and implementing preventative actions. Monitoring and improving KPIs relating to reliability, maintenance performance, compliance, energy, water usage, costs and environmental performance. Identifying opportunities to improve OEE, product quality, efficiency, yield and waste reduction. Managing specialist engineering contractors and service providers. Controlling maintenance budgets and contributing to capital investment planning. Leading engineering projects from concept through commissioning and handover. Supporting decarbonisation initiatives and sustainability improvements across the site. Working closely with Production, Quality, HSE, Environmental, Reliability and Project Engineering teams to achieve site objectives. About Refresco Refresco is the global independent beverage solutions provider for Global, National and Emerging brands, and retailers. We offer an extensive range of product and packaging combinations, producing everything from juices and carbonated soft drinks to mineral waters. In the UK, we employ over 1,800 colleagues across six manufacturing sites, producing private-label soft drinks and fruit juices for many of the country's leading retailers.
